
Singapore-based hospitality giant Ascott is set to unveil its first property in Macau next Monday, marking a significant expansion into the region. The Ascott Macau, located in the city's business district, will offer 110 serviced apartment units designed to cater to both short and long-term stays, emphasizing a "homes away from home" concept.

A New Standard in Macau Accommodation
The Ascott Macau aims to provide a comfortable and convenient living experience, particularly for business travelers. Each of the 110 serviced apartments, measuring between 30 and 75 square meters, will be equipped with essential kitchen amenities such as a coffee machine, electric kettle, microwave oven, and refrigerator.
Extensive Facilities for Residents
Beyond the individual apartments, residents will have access to a comprehensive range of facilities. These include a well-equipped gym, indoor heated and outdoor swimming pools, a Jacuzzi, and a sauna room. For relaxation and socializing, a residents' lounge will be available, alongside three on-site restaurants offering Japanese, Chinese, and Western cuisines.
Global Presence and Future Plans
Ascott, recognized as the world's largest international serviced residence owner-operator, currently manages over 26,000 serviced residential units globally. Its portfolio spans major cities across Europe, Asia, Australia, India, and the Gulf region. The opening of Ascott Macau is part of a larger strategy, with the company planning to launch seven new properties across China within the next 18 to 24 months.
Additional services at The Ascott Macau will include a scheduled shuttle bus service to the Macau Ferry Terminal and curated resident programs designed to enhance the guest experience.
